Benefits of eating raw amla
- It has the highest amount of vitamin C. It strengthens immunity and improves skin.
- Being rich in fiber, it improves digestion. It also provides relief from constipation.
- The rich presence of antioxidants prevents hair fall. This also makes your hair stronger.
- It is also beneficial for our heart health. Actually, it helps in controlling cholesterol.
What are its drawbacks
It has many benefits but let us tell you that raw amla is very sour in taste, due to which some people do not like to eat it. Also, it cannot be stored for a long time.
benefits of amla powder
- It can be easily taken by mixing it with water, honey or smoothie.
- It also works to increase metabolism . Due to which it becomes easier to lose weight.
- It is also effective in enhancing the beauty of your skin and hair.
- Consuming Amla powder detoxifies the liver.
What are its drawbacks
Let us tell you that after drying and grinding it, some amount of vitamin C gets destroyed. Therefore, it is slightly less effective than raw amla.
Benefits of eating dry amla
- The fiber present in it improves digestion.
- Also, it absorbs iron better in the body.
- You can eat it as a snack.
Also know its drawbacks
If sugar is added to it, it can do more harm than good to you. Also, Vitamin C also gets reduced.
Who is the best?
Now you must be wondering which of these three would be the best. So let us tell you that raw amla is the best option. But if there is a fear of its sourness or spoiling quickly, then amla powder can also be a good option. Dry amla is better when it is not added with sugar.
